Course Description:
Science Capstone is a collaborative and adaptive approach used to investigate biological (including environmental) concerns or questions. Students are given a biological or environmental issue and use a scientific approach to find a solution. Students must integrate relevant biological or environmental and social-cultural information to research a question, and develop either a management plan for a given landscape unit or produce a scientific report. Students will develop collaboration and team management skills through consensus building, planning, project execution and reporting. Students with less than 90 earned credits will need to complete a ?missing pre-requisite? form during pre-registration to register for this course. Prerequisites: MAT 210 Statistics and (BIO 210 General Ecology or FOR 310 Forest Ecology) and Senior Status.
